Comparing PM to Sector and Country
PM pays a solid dividend yield of 5.51%, which is higher than the average of the bottom 25% of dividend payers in the US market (0.92%). PM’s dividend yield is lower than the average of the top 25% of dividend payers in the Consumer Defensive sector in the US market (5.81%), which means that there are more attractive dividend stocks to consider.
